How Our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al Service Actually Works
When your sump pump fails, water can quickly rise to up to 2 inches in just a few minutes. That’s why prompt action is crucial to preventing further damage. Our team will arrive quickly, assess the situation, and get to work extracting water and drying out the area. We’ll use specialized equipment, such as portable pumps and dehumidifiers, to ensure the job is done right the first time.
Step 1: Initial Assessment
Our team will arrive on-site and conduct a thorough assessment of the damage to find out the best course of action. We’ll identify the source of the problem and create a customized plan to get your home back to normal. This step typically takes around 30 minutes to complete.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, our team will use specialized equipment to extract the water from the affected area. We’ll use powerful pumps to remove standing water and debris, and then use wet vacuums to dry out the area. This step typically takes around 2-3 hours to complete,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out the area and prevent mold and mildew growth. We’ll use dehumidifiers to reduce the moisture levels in the air, and then use specialized fans to circulate the air and speed up the drying process. This step typically takes around 3-5 days to complete.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Finally, our team will conduct a thorough inspection of the area to ensure that all water and debris have been removed. We’ll also clean and disinfect the area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This step typically takes around 1-2 hours to complete.

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al Cost In Centreville, VA
The cost of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al in Centreville, VA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and other local conditions. But, here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the area to be dried and the amount of equipment needed. |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| The complexity of the job and the amount of cleaning required. |
| Emergency Service Fee | $200 – $500 | The time of day and day of the week the service is performed. |
| Equipment Rental Fee | $100 – $500 | The type and amount of equipment needed for the job. |

Common Questions About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al
Q: How long will it take to complete a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al service?
A: The length of time required to complete a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al service will depend on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. But, our team typically takes around 3-5 days to complete the job, depending on the complexity of the task.
Q: Will I need to replace my sump pump after a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al service?
A: It’s possible that your sump pump may need to be replaced after a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al service, depending on the cause of the failure. But, our team will assess the situation and recommend the best course of action to prevent future failures.
Q: Is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al covered by insurance?
A: In most cases,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al is covered by insurance. But, it’s best to check with your insurance provider to confirm coverage and any applicable deductibles.
Q: Can I prevent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al from occurring in the first place?
A: Yes, you can prevent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al from occurring in the first place by regularly maintaining your sump pump, checking for blockages, and ensuring proper drainage. Also, our team offers preventative maintenance services to help you stay ahead of potential problems.
